# 云原生环境安全工具部署复杂:问题分析与AI赋能解决方案
## 引言
随着云计算技术的迅猛发展,云原生架构逐渐成为企业数字化转型的重要选择。然而,云原生环境下的安全工具部署复杂性问题日益凸显,成为制约企业安全防护能力提升的瓶颈。本文将深入分析云原生环境安全工具部署的复杂性,并探讨如何利用AI技术有效解决这一问题。
## 一、云原生环境安全工具部署的复杂性
### 1.1 微服务架构带来的挑战
云原生环境通常采用微服务架构,服务数量众多、分布广泛,导致安全工具的部署和管理难度大幅增加。每个微服务可能需要独立的安全配置和策略,这使得安全工具的部署变得极为复杂。
### 1.2 容器化环境的动态性
容器技术的广泛应用使得云原生环境更加动态和灵活,容器的快速创建和销毁对安全工具的实时性和适应性提出了更高要求。传统的安全工具难以适应这种高度动态的环境。
### 1.3 多层抽象带来的复杂性
云原生环境中的多层抽象(如容器、Pod、Service等)增加了安全工具部署的复杂性。每一层都可能需要不同的安全策略和工具,导致整体部署和管理难度加大。
### 1.4 安全工具的兼容性问题
不同云原生平台和工具之间的兼容性问题也是部署复杂性的重要原因。企业在选择和使用安全工具时,往往需要考虑多种技术和平台的兼容性,增加了部署的复杂性。
## 二、AI技术在云原生环境安全中的应用场景
### 2.1 智能威胁检测
AI技术可以通过机器学习和深度学习算法,对云原生环境中的海量数据进行实时分析,识别出潜在的威胁和异常行为。相比于传统规则引擎,AI技术能够更精准地检测新型攻击和未知威胁。
### 2.2 自动化安全配置
AI技术可以自动学习和优化安全配置策略,根据环境变化和威胁情报动态调整安全配置,减少人工干预,提高安全工具的部署效率和准确性。
### 2.3 行为基线分析
通过AI技术建立正常行为基线,实时监控和分析系统行为,一旦发现偏离基线的行为,立即触发报警和响应机制,有效提升安全防护能力。
### 2.4 安全事件响应
AI技术可以自动化安全事件的响应流程,快速识别和定位安全事件,提供智能化的响应建议和操作指导,缩短事件响应时间,降低安全风险。
## 三、AI赋能的云原生环境安全工具部署解决方案
### 3.1 智能化安全工具部署平台
#### 3.1.1 平台架构设计
构建一个基于AI的智能化安全工具部署平台,平台应包含数据采集层、智能分析层、策略管理层和执行层。数据采集层负责收集云原生环境中的各类安全数据;智能分析层利用AI算法对数据进行实时分析;策略管理层根据分析结果动态生成和调整安全策略;执行层负责将策略应用到具体的安全工具中。
#### 3.1.2 关键技术实现
- **数据采集与预处理**:采用分布式数据采集技术,确保数据的全面性和实时性;通过数据清洗和标准化处理,提高数据质量。
- **AI算法应用**:引入机器学习和深度学习算法,如异常检测、行为基线分析等,提升威胁检测的准确性和效率。
- **策略动态调整**:基于AI分析结果,动态生成和调整安全策略,确保安全配置的实时性和适应性。
### 3.2 自动化安全配置管理
#### 3.2.1 配置模板化
将常见的安全配置策略模板化,通过AI技术自动匹配和应用最适合当前环境的配置模板,减少人工配置的工作量和错误率。
#### 3.2.2 配置优化与验证
利用AI技术对已部署的安全配置进行持续优化和验证,确保配置的有效性和合规性。通过模拟攻击和压力测试,验证配置的实际防护效果。
### 3.3 智能化安全事件响应
#### 3.3.1 事件自动识别与分类
通过AI技术对安全事件进行自动识别和分类,快速定位事件类型和影响范围,提高事件响应的针对性和效率。
#### 3.3.2 智能响应建议
基于AI分析结果,提供智能化的响应建议和操作指导,帮助安全团队快速采取有效措施,降低安全事件的影响。
### 3.4 安全工具兼容性优化
#### 3.4.1 兼容性测试与评估
利用AI技术对安全工具在不同云原生平台上的兼容性进行自动化测试和评估,提前发现和解决兼容性问题。
#### 3.4.2 兼容性适配方案
基于测试结果,生成兼容性适配方案,通过AI技术自动调整安全工具的配置和参数,确保其在不同平台上的稳定运行。
## 四、案例分析与实践经验
### 4.1 某大型企业的云原生安全实践
某大型企业在数字化转型过程中,面临云原生环境安全工具部署复杂的挑战。通过引入AI赋能的智能化安全工具部署平台,实现了安全工具的自动化部署和配置管理,显著提升了安全防护能力。
#### 4.1.1 项目背景
该企业采用微服务架构和容器技术,安全工具部署和管理难度大,传统安全工具难以适应动态变化的云原生环境。
#### 4.1.2 解决方案
- **智能化安全工具部署平台**:构建基于AI的智能化安全工具部署平台,实现安全数据的实时采集和分析,动态生成和调整安全策略。
- **自动化安全配置管理**:通过模板化和AI优化,实现安全配置的自动化管理和持续验证。
- **智能化安全事件响应**:利用AI技术实现安全事件的自动识别和智能响应。
#### 4.1.3 实施效果
- **部署效率提升**:安全工具部署时间缩短50%以上。
- **威胁检测能力增强**:威胁检测准确率提升30%。
- **事件响应速度加快**:安全事件响应时间缩短40%。
### 4.2 行业最佳实践总结
通过对多个成功案例的分析,总结出以下云原生环境安全工具部署的最佳实践:
- **标准化与自动化**:通过标准化安全配置和自动化部署,降低部署复杂性和人工干预。
- **AI赋能**:充分利用AI技术在威胁检测、配置管理和事件响应等方面的优势,提升安全防护能力。
- **持续优化**:建立持续优化机制,定期评估和优化安全工具的部署和配置,确保安全防护效果。
## 五、未来展望
随着AI技术的不断发展和云原生环境的日益复杂,未来云原生环境安全工具部署将更加智能化和自动化。以下是几个可能的趋势:
### 5.1 AI与安全工具的深度融合
AI技术将更加深入地融入安全工具的各个环节,从数据采集、分析到策略生成和执行,实现全流程的智能化管理。
### 5.2 自适应安全防护体系
基于AI技术的自适应安全防护体系将逐渐成为主流,能够根据环境变化和威胁态势动态调整防护策略,实现更加精准和高效的安全防护。
### 5.3 多维度的安全数据融合分析
通过多维度的安全数据融合分析,结合AI技术,能够更全面地识别和应对复杂的安全威胁,提升整体安全防护能力。
## 结语
云原生环境安全工具部署复杂性问题是一个多维度、多层次的挑战,需要综合运用多种技术和方法来解决。AI技术的引入为解决这一问题提供了新的思路和方法。通过构建智能化安全工具部署平台、实现自动化安全配置管理和智能化安全事件响应,可以有效提升云原生环境的安全防护能力。未来,随着AI技术的不断发展和应用,云原生环境安全将迎来更加智能和高效的防护新时代。